3.26 Consider the reaction A + B r =0.15(mint) CA in a CSTR. A costs $2/mole, and B sells for $5/mole. The cost of the operating the reactor is $0.03 per liter hour. We need to produce 100 moles of B/hour using CA =2 moles/liter. Assume no value or cost of disposal of unreacted (a) What is the optimum conversion and reactor size? (6) What is the cash flow from the process? (c) What is the cash flow ignoring operating cost? (d) At what operating cost do we break even?
